## Export Retry Provenance

New to the Bramblecart team: failed exports retry up to three times via the Hollis queue. Each retry is stamped with the originating build so we can trace regressions. Never retry manually without checking provenance first. The current verified build token for the retry worker appears below.

pipeline stamp: htk9_6ce9d33c5

Ticket: Vault lockout blocking release. The Greywick static-analysis baseline file is stored in the Pinefort vault, which auto-locked after three failed fetch attempts by CI last night. Without the baseline, the release pipeline flags 1,200 pre-existing warnings as new and blocks the cut. No code change is needed — the baseline is current as of last sprint. Release manager action: unlock the vault and re-run the gate. To unlock it, use the recovery passphrase noted directly below.

unlock words, hahip-yagef: zorok-novmir-zorix-silax

Subject: DR drill — bounce processor

To future maintainers of the Wrenbolt bounce processor: next week's disaster-recovery drill will take the primary ingestion node offline to confirm that bounce events queue safely and replay without duplicates. Follow the failover runbook in the Hollowmere wiki. Should the standby console prompt for credentials, use the recovery passphrase listed below.

vault phrase of bagaf-kajeg = jorath-feniel-briir-siliel-ralix